1. Suppose you plan to retire at age 70, and you want to be able to withdraw an amount of $85,000 per year on each birthday from age 70 to age 100 (a total of 31 withdrawals). If the account which contains your savings earns 6.5% per year simple interest, how much money needs to be in the account by the time you reach your 70th birthday? (Answer to the nearest dollar.)

Hint: This can be solved as a 30-year ordinary annuity plus one withdrawal at age 70, or as a 31-year annuity due.

2. Today is your 25th birthday, and you want to save $1.2 Million by your birthday at age 70. If you expect to earn 6% APR compounded monthly in your retirement account, what constant payment at the end of each month must you deposit into the account through your 70th birthday in order to reach your retirement savings goal on your 70th birthday? (Answer to the nearest penny.)

3. A 7.2% coupon bearing bond pays interest semi-annually and has a maturity of 4 years. If the annual yield to maturity is 5.9%, what is the current price of this bond? (Answer to the nearest penny.)
